Description

Overview

The Teamcenter with AWC Developer plays a crucial role in leveraging their expertise to develop, customize, and maintain Teamcenter applications, particularly around Active Workspace Client (AWC). They play an integral part in enhancing and optimizing the Product Lifecycle Management (PLM) system and its integration with Computer-Aided Design (CAD) tools.

Key Responsibilities
Develop and customize Teamcenter applications, with a focus on AWC implementation and optimization

Collaborate with cross-functional teams to understand business requirements and translate them into technical solutions within Teamcenter

Utilize programming languages such as Java and C++ to build and modify Teamcenter functionalities

Design, develop, and implement integrations between Teamcenter and CAD tools

Ensure the scalability, performance, and reliability of Teamcenter applications by conducting thorough testing and troubleshooting

Bachelor's degree in Computer Science, Engineering, or a related field

6-8 yrs experience in developing and customizing applications within the Teamcenter environment

Strong knowledge of Active Workspace Client (AWC) and its implementation in Teamcenter

  Proficiency in programming languages such as Java, C++, and scripting languages

Experience with CAD tools and their integration with PLM systems

Ability to understand and analyze complex business requirements and translate them into technical solutions

Excellent problem-solving skills and the ability to troubleshoot and debug complex issues

Strong communication and collaboration skills to work effectively in cross-functional teams

Experience in conducting testing, performance optimization, and maintenance of applications

Knowledge of version control systems and configuration management tools

Ability to prioritize tasks, manage timelines, and deliver high-quality solutions under pressure

Understanding of security principles and best practices in application development

Relevant certifications in PLM or AWC development are a plus

Ability to adapt to new technologies and learn quickly in a dynamic environment

 

 

 

Education

Bachelor's Degree